Balfour Beatty provides extensive building, construction, mechanical and electrical (M&E) engineering and facilities management services to retail customers in the UK, US, South-East Asia and Dubai.

Projects range from complete refurbishment works to major retail complexes, as an ongoing partner or for a specific scheme. For example, Balfour Kilpatrick has won more than 60 contracts for Marks & Spencer over five years and, in 2004, Dutco Balfour Beatty won the £400 million contract to build the Burj Mall retail development in Dubai, the world’s biggest shopping centre.

In the UK, projects include: Harvey Nichols in Edinburgh; the Houndshill Shopping Centre in Blackpool; John Lewis on Oxford Street, London; the Paradise Project in Liverpool; and Selfridges at Birmingham's Bullring shopping centre.

In the US, Heery International provides interior design and project management services to the retail industry. Balfour Beatty Construction US has completed more than 75 retail projects valued at over $400 million. These include projects for clients such as the Bank of America, for which it is providing construction services.

In South-East Asia, we have the capability to provide a range of construction services through Gammon, our joint venture business. It was the design and build contractor for IKEA's store in Shanghai, PRC, and completed the main building works for French retailer Carrefour's megastore in Onnuch, Bangkok, Thailand.
